  • Patent number: 11484979
    Abstract: A precision tripod motion system is provided. The tripod motion system in one example includes a bottom plate including three spaced-apart bottom single-degree-of-freedom hinges, a top plate including three spaced-apart top three-degrees-of-freedom (TDOF) joints, wherein the top plate is configured to receive a workpiece. Each linear actuator of three linear actuators is coupled to an associated SDOF hinge of the bottom plate and coupled to an associated TDOF joint of the top plate. Each linear actuator is configured to change length over a linear actuation span and configured to return the top plate to a predetermined set position after the top plate is displaced by an external force Each linear actuator includes a ball coupled to the associated three TDOF joint and a positioning actuator configured to move the ball to the predetermined set position prior to the return of the top plate to the predetermined set position.

  • Patent number: 9694455
    Abstract: A precision tripod motion system is provided. The tripod motion system in one example includes a bottom plate including three spaced-apart bottom single-degree-of-freedom (SDOF) hinge portions, a top plate including three spaced-apart top three-degrees-of-freedom (TDOF) joint portions, with the top plate configured to receive a workpiece, three linear actuators pivotally coupled to the three bottom SDOF hinge portions of the bottom plate and coupled to the three top TDOF joint portions of the top plate, with each linear actuator of the three linear actuators configured to change length over a linear actuation span, and a rotator component and/or a positioning table affixed to the top plate and the bottom plate. The tripod motion system is additionally coupled to a rotator component and a positioning table to provide six degrees of freedom of motion.
